ASTM A369 Grade FP12 vs. SAE-AISI 1050 Steel

Both ASTM A369 grade FP12 and SAE-AISI 1050 steel are iron alloys. They have a very high 98%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 31 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(2,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is ASTM A369 grade FP12 and the bottom bar is SAE-AISI 1050 steel.
